Output 3c3c9e0e853f4a4037df9ac6da6b0cdde12df020806c5af4977b8af2801fcebb:6

value
616199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 493ac0599f56568eecfd7e5f91e3f04569e7497c OP_EQUAL
address
38NDdfToBp6mnLVxMddTQQim2EGsZkqNvQ
transaction
3c3c9e0e853f4a4037df9ac6da6b0cdde12df020806c5af4977b8af2801fcebb
confirmations
177883
spent
true